About This Role

As a Social Care Assistant, you will play a key role in promoting the wellbeing, inclusion and enjoyment of our residents. Your primary responsibility will be to facilitate individual, group and community-based lifestyle activities that cater to the physical, social, cultural and spiritual needs of our residents.

Your Key Responsibilities

  • Document Resident Profiles: Document resident profiles and assist in developing, implementing and evaluating individual care plans.
  • Lifestyle Activities: Contribute to the planning, coordination and delivery of group and individual activities such as workshops, events and outings.
  • Resource Management: Maintain and manage resources for the activities program, ensuring they are up-to-date and relevant to the residents' needs.
  • Communication: Prepare and distribute newsletters, activity notices and related correspondence to keep residents and their families informed about upcoming events and activities.
  • Volunteer Coordination: Support the Social Care Co-ordinator and General Manager in coordinating and supervising volunteers who participate in the activities program.
  • Other Duties: Perform other duties as directed by the organisation that align with your skills and abilities.
